Eulerian Computations of a Confined Shaped Charge.

Abstract

Three computations have been carried out for three distinct configurations of confined and unconfined shaped charges. The shape was inferred for all three cases for which the initial shape was a convex disk. For two of the cases the asymptotic shape predicted was a flat disk and an ogive. In the last case the plate apparently breaks up before achieving its final shape.
